The Bridgeport Rescue Mission's Great Thanksgiving Project has begun ahead of the upcoming holiday.
Organizers gave away turkeys and the fixings Thursday at the Hartford HealthCare Amphitheatre.
The nonprofit will distribute turkeys to more than 7,000 families in need this year.
Turkeys and all the fixings will be distributed at the amphitheater Friday from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m.
The amphitheater is located at 500 Broad St. in Bridgeport.
